Electric 5k–6k Draw Bar Pull (DBP) Burden Carrier TractorThe United States Coast Guard Aviation Logistics Center is conducting market research through a Request for Information (RFI) to identify sources capable of providing or manufacturing an electric burden carrier tractor with a draw bar pull force ranging from 5,000 to 6,000 pounds. This conventional tow tractor must meet specified dimensional, performance, and operational requirements including a maximum length of 150 inches with hitches, a height no taller than 90 inches with cab and beacon, and a gross vehicle weight between 7,000 and 10,000 pounds. The tractor must be electrically powered by a lithium-ion battery with at least a 10kW capacity, have onboard and optional external charging systems compatible with specified voltage inputs, and be capable of multiple operating speeds with features such as hydrostatic and power steering, emergency steering, and a robust braking system that complies with industry safety standards. The cab must be enclosed, climate-controlled with heating and optional air conditioning, and designed for maximum visibility and operator safety, including seatbelts and safety switches. Additional design and operational criteria include corrosion resistance through specialized coatings and rustproofing, structural provisions for transportability and secure tie-downs, operator controls with clear markings, and mandated safety equipment such as an audible backup alarm, fire extinguisher, and lighting systems meeting road traffic regulations. The first unit is to be delivered 120 to 160 days after order receipt, with an estimated total of 116 production units. Respondents are requested to provide detailed capability and business information, including company size, certifications, government experience, warranty terms, delivery schedules, training offerings, and pricing estimates for shipping to Elizabeth City, North Carolina. Responses to this RFI are for informational purposes only and do not constitute a contract or commitment; no proposals or quotations are being solicited at this time. The government intends to issue a formal Request for Quotes later based on the information collected, and submissions are due by early July 2026.

3930--EQUIPMENT - HEAVY-DUTY FORKLIFT BRAND NAME OR EQUALThe Department of Veterans Affairs is conducting a Sources Sought Announcement to identify qualified businesses capable of supplying a heavy-duty forklift for the Northport VA Medical Center Grounds Department. This announcement is for market research purposes only and does not constitute a solicitation or request for proposals. The forklift sought is a 6,000-pound capacity, 4-wheel, diesel-powered forklift with specific features such as a Sellick SLP 60K4e-4PS model or equivalent. Key specifications include a Kohler 2.5L Tier 4 turbocharged diesel engine, fully automatic powershift transmission, 4WD axles, enclosed cab with heater, block heater, and various safety and operational features. The equipment must be hydraulically operated with pneumatic tires, meet rigorous performance and safety standards, and be maintainable by a local factory-certified repair facility. Interested respondents must provide detailed capability statements along with company information including socio-economic status, contact details, SAM UEI number, Cage Code, and Tax ID. The contractor will be responsible for delivery, installation, and transportation of the forklift to the Northport VA Medical Center. The Government expects responses by June 18, 2026, 3:00 PM EST, and no costs related to this inquiry will be reimbursed. Offers of brand name or equal products must meet all physical, functional, and performance requirements outlined, and any deviations must be clearly detailed. The procurement falls under NAICS code 333924 with a size standard of 900 employees, and there is no set-aside for this acquisition.

This contract solicits quotes for the purchase of one Aircraft Tow Tractor, specifically a Tractor Aircraft Tug U-30 (TMX-450-50), for use by the 402d Aircraft Maintenance Group at Robins Air Force Base, Georgia. The contractor is responsible for supplying the equipment along with transportation, documentation, manuals, and necessary training. The acquisition is designated as a brand name requirement for TLD America Corporation, reflecting the specific need for this model, which is manufactured in France. The solicitation, issued as Request for Quote (RFQ) No. FA857126Q0064, follows the Federal Acquisition Regulation subpart 12.6 procedures for commercial items and has undergone multiple updates to incorporate required clauses and address technical or administrative corrections. The deadline for submitting questions was initially set for April 23, 2026, and the offer submission deadline was extended to May 8, 2026, with final responses due by May 18, 2026. Key points of contact include Taylor Walker and Robert Robinson from the Department of Defense’s Maintenance Contracting Office at Robins AFB, ensuring clear communication channels throughout the procurement process.

This is a combined synopsis/solicitation for commercial items prepared in accordance with the format in FAR subpart 12.6 as supplemented with additional information included in this notice.


This announcement constitutes the solicitation only; a quote is being requested, and a written solicitation will not be issued. This solicitation is being issued as a Request for Quote (RFQ) No. FA857126Q0064.

This requirement is for the purchase of one (1) Aircraft Tow Tractor, in which the Contractor shall provide all the equipment, transportation, documentation/manuals and training for a Tractor Aircraft Tug U-30 (TMX-450-50) for the 402d Aircraft 
Maintenance Group (AMXG) at Robins Air Force Base (AFB), Georgia


This is acquisition is being solicited as a Brand Name requirement for TLD America Corporation.

All questions must be received by 12:00 PM EST on 23 April 2026. Please send all questions to Ms. Taylor Walker at taylor.walker.10@us.af.mil.



This solicitation is hereby extended to 8 May 2026. Offers must be submitted by 1:00 PM EST.
FA857126Q00640001 also incorporated provisions/clauses that are necessary. 


FA857126Q00640002 is hereby issued to incorporate additional clauses that address procurement of the TMX-450-50 which is manufactured in France.
FA857126Q00640003 is hereby issued to correct system glitch and ensure all clauses are included.


FA857126Q00640004 is hereby issued to extend the RFQ one (1) final time to allow interested parties to incorporate the answers received after questions.
